This workshop will introduce you to the most recent feature of CLiC: user-defined annotation. CLiC’s annotation component can be used to support the classification of linguistic features and specific patterns in a corpus of fiction. With exercises that are designed for the study of 19th century fiction we will introduce you to options of adding information to corpus outputs and generating specific frequency information that can support the analysis of literary texts.

Attendance of workshop 1 is not a requirement for the attendance of this workshop. You do not need any specific background for this session.
